How to Choose the Right Goal Zero Plug & Accessories

Choosing the right Goal Zero plug and accompanying accessories can significantly enhance your portable power experience. Whether you’re building a solar power setup, needing a replacement cord, or extending your reach, understanding the key features is crucial. Here’s a guide to help you navigate the options.

Voltage & Wattage Compatibility

The most important consideration is ensuring compatibility with your Goal Zero Yeti power station and solar panels. Goal Zero uses various port types and voltage requirements. For larger Yeti models (1,000W or greater), you’ll need a “High Power Port” cable like the Goal Zero 30-Foot High Power Port Cable. These cables are designed to handle higher wattage inputs from larger solar panels. Using the wrong wattage cable can limit charging speed or, in worst cases, damage your equipment. Conversely, smaller Yetis or specific adapters (like those for the Yeti 150 or 400) require cables rated for 15V, as seen in the 15V 60W Replacement Charger. Incorrect voltage will prevent charging or potentially harm your devices.

Cable Length & Extension Needs

Consider the distance between your power station and your power source (solar panels, AC outlet). Shorter cables (like the 6ft PKPOWER AC Power Cord) are suitable for direct connections, while extension cables are essential for flexibility. The PAEKQ SAE to Anderson Solar Extension Cable and MJPOWER Anderson-to-8mm cable offer extended reach for optimal solar panel positioning. Longer cables offer convenience but can introduce slight voltage drop, especially with higher power demands. Choose a length that meets your needs without excessive slack.

Connector Types & Adaptability

Goal Zero utilizes several connector types, including Anderson Powerpole, SAE, and standard AC prongs. Assess which connectors are present on your devices. The PAEKQ SAE to Anderson cable cleverly includes a polarity reverse adapter, addressing compatibility issues between brands, and the Anderson connector can be adapted for horizontal or vertical Goal Zero models. If your solar panels have different connectors than your Yeti, you’ll need an adapter cable like the MJPOWER Anderson-to-8mm cable. Understanding connector types ensures a secure and efficient connection.

Safety Features & Certifications

Quality and safety are paramount. Look for cables and adapters with built-in protections like Over Voltage Protection (OVP), Over Current Protection (OCP), and Short Circuit Protection (SCP), as found in the PKPOWER cord and KFD 16V Adapter. Certifications like CE, FCC, and RoHS indicate the product has met specific safety and quality standards. A battery management system, mentioned in the Goal Zero product description, is also a sign of a well-engineered product. Prioritize safety certifications to protect your valuable equipment and prevent hazards.

Additional Features

  • Wire Gauge: Thicker gauge wires (10AWG or 14AWG) offer lower resistance and better power transmission, particularly over longer distances.
  • Durability: Look for cables with robust construction and durable jackets, especially for outdoor use.
  • Warranty: A longer warranty period demonstrates the manufacturer’s confidence in their product.

FAQs

What is the most important factor when choosing a Goal Zero plug?

The most critical factor is ensuring voltage and wattage compatibility with your Goal Zero Yeti power station and solar panels. Using an incompatible plug can limit charging speed or even damage your equipment. Always check the specifications of your devices before purchasing a Goal Zero plug.

What do cable length and gauge have to do with performance?

Longer cables offer convenience, but can introduce voltage drop, especially with higher power demands. Thicker gauge wires (10AWG or 14AWG) minimize resistance and improve power transmission, particularly over longer distances when charging your Goal Zero Yeti.

What safety features should I look for in a Goal Zero plug or cable?

Prioritize cables and adapters with built-in protections like Over Voltage Protection (OVP), Over Current Protection (OCP), and Short Circuit Protection (SCP). Certifications like CE, FCC, and RoHS also indicate adherence to safety and quality standards.

What type of connector is most common with Goal Zero products?

Goal Zero utilizes several connector types, including Anderson Powerpole, SAE, and standard AC prongs. The PAEKQ SAE to Anderson cable is popular for solar panel connectivity, offering a polarity reverse adapter for broader compatibility. Understanding these connector types is key to a secure and efficient setup.
